South Korea Millet Based Packaged Food Market Overview

The South Korea Millet Based Packaged Food Market is experiencing notable growth, driven by evolving consumer preferences, health consciousness, and a rising demand for functional and natural food products. As consumers increasingly seek alternatives to traditional grains, millet-based offerings are gaining prominence due to their nutritional benefits, gluten-free nature, and versatility. This sector is emerging as a strategic investment opportunity within South Korea’s broader packaged food industry, reflecting shifting dietary trends and innovative product development.

Market Challenges and Restraints

Despite promising growth prospects, the South Korea millet-based packaged food market faces several challenges that could temper expansion. Cost barriers associated with processing millet into diverse product formats can limit profit margins and price competitiveness. Regulatory complexities related to food safety standards and labeling requirements may pose hurdles for new entrants and product innovation.

Infrastructure limitations, particularly in rural millet cultivation areas, can impact supply chain stability and scalability. Market competition from established grains like rice, wheat, and barley also constrains millet’s market share, requiring continuous innovation and branding efforts. Additionally, supply chain constraints, including seasonal variability and import dependencies, may affect product availability and pricing stability.
